Output 284c73ded106190c782a1643da14e47e8cf02cf9088e0fbe35c29818392a3ba1:2

value
42605
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e37d523f992bccb37087c888fe0699133be95ed547163ea9240136c39e2e340a
address
bc1pud74y0ue90xtxuy8ezy0up5ezva7jhk4gutra2fyqymv883wxs9qv85u6z
transaction
284c73ded106190c782a1643da14e47e8cf02cf9088e0fbe35c29818392a3ba1
spent
true